A KPMG Case Study
The customer, a multinational grocery retailer, faced a challenge in ensuring the accuracy of its sustainability data, which heavily relied on third-party supplier information. With increasing regulatory scrutiny from the EU's Corporate Sustainability Reporting Directive (CSRD), this risked undermining confidence in its non-financial reporting. KPMG, serving as both financial statement auditor and ESG assurance provider, leveraged its KPMG Clara platform to address this.
KPMG's solution involved expanding independent laboratory testing to validate supplier data for private label products. This process revealed discrepancies, which led to strengthened data controls and clearer internal accountability for the retailer. As a result, the company gained greater confidence in its sustainability disclosures and was better positioned for future regulatory requirements. KPMG's work provided robust assurance and delivered valuable insights for ongoing improvement.
